Comprehending Weight Loss Drugs
Weight-loss drugs can be categorized into numerous categories based upon their mechanism of action. Broadly, they can be divided into the following classifications:
Category
Description
Examples
Appetite Suppressants
These drugs work by decreasing cravings signals to the brain.
Phentermine, Diethylpropion
Fat Absorption Inhibitors
They prevent the absorption of fat from the diet, leading to fewer calories.
Orlistat (Alli, Xenical)
Metabolic Boosters
These medications assist to increase metabolic rate and lower fat build-up.
Phentermine/topiramate combination
GLP-1 Receptor Agonists
Mimic hormonal agents that regulate cravings and insulin release.
Liraglutide (Saxenda), Semaglutide (Ozempic)
Combination Medications
These include several active components that target various aspects of weight loss.
Qsymia
Effectiveness and Safety
The efficiency of weight reduction drugs can differ significantly from person to individual. Most of these medications have actually been revealed to help individuals drop weight when combined with a healthy diet plan and routine workout. Here are some insights into their effectiveness:
Drug
Average Weight Loss
Typical Side Effects
Phentermine
5-10% of body weight
Increased heart rate, sleeping disorders
Orlistat
5-10% of body weight
Gastrointestinal problems
Liraglutide
5-10% of body weight
Nausea, diarrhea
Semaglutide
10-15% of body weight
Queasiness, vomiting
Security Considerations
While weight loss medications can help in accomplishing weight-loss goals, they are not without dangers. Some essential safety considerations consist of:
- Consultation with a Healthcare Provider: It is crucial to talk with a health care provider before beginning any weight-loss medication to determine viability based on private health conditions and weight loss objectives.
- Prospective Drug Interactions: Weight loss drugs might engage with other medications. A comprehensive review by a healthcare provider can assist prevent problems.
- Comprehending Side Effects: Familiarizing oneself with the adverse effects can assist handle expectations and lower anxiety about beginning a brand-new medication.
Where to Purchase Weight Loss Drugs Safely
Purchasing weight reduction drugs need to be approached meticulously to guarantee security and effectiveness. Below are some pointers on where to buy these medications:
Authorized Pharmacies
- Always choose for certified drug stores that require a physician's prescription.
- In-Person Pharmacies: Purchasing from a physical pharmacy permits direct communication with pharmacists who can provide suggestions and fill up prescriptions as required.
Online Pharmacies
- Ensure the online pharmacy is respectable and requires a legitimate prescription.
- Confirmation can be done by examining if the pharmacy is accredited, for example, by the National Association of Boards of Pharmacy (NABP).
Health Clinics or Specialized Weight Loss Centers
- Some clinics provide prescription weight-loss medications along with individualized health insurance.
- Health care professionals in these settings can provide tailored advice and supervision throughout the weight-loss journey.
